> Ok, this feels a bit silly to ask, but what would be a convenient
> folder? Should I move it later? Does it matter where i have it when i
> run it later?

I have mine in /root
It really doesn't matter where you place it because you will specify the 
name on the cvsup command line (something like cvsup /root/my-supfile). 
  The only reason to copy it somewhere is so that you still have the 
original in case something goes wrong.
